How quickly must I act to prevent mold after a leak?

The microbial growth window is 48-72 hours post-intrusion. Under 2026 insurance and liability standards, mitigation must begin within this window to meet the 'Standard of Care.' What is 'Grey Water,' and how can smart sensors help my insurance?

Category 2 'Grey Water' contains significant contamination (e.g., dishwasher leaks). It is distinct from clean (Category 1) or hazardous black water (Category 3). My floors feel dry to the touch. Is my Houserville home really dry?

No. 'Dry to touch' is a surface condition. Structural drying follows the IICRC S500 psychrometric standard: air must reach 40 Grains Per Pound (GPP) at 70°F. Vapor pressure within wall cavities and subfloors in Houserville Residential Center can remain elevated, leading to hidden moisture and secondary damage. We validate dryness with thermo-hygrometer readings, not touch.
